2. The Present Simple
It’s used to express facts, habits, in newspaper
headlines or dates of transport means.
Examples :
They usually go to club. (habit)
The sun sets at the west. ( fact)
PACE NEGOTIATIONS PROGRESS.
(newspaper headline)
3. Forms and Signs of Present Simple
With singular pronouns we put (s) with regular verbs.
Example:
He works She cooks
With verbs that end with (sh – ss – ch – o – x – z ) we put (es) at the end
of the verb.
Example: passes – crosses – boxes – goes
With verbs end with (y) and before it a consonant letter, we change it to
(ies)
Example: carry- carries, try- tries
He/ She/ It / singular Pronoun : s – es – ies
They/ We/You/I : Infinitive

5. Negation in Present Simple
We use (never) with signs of this tense.
Example:
He usually behaves carelessly He never behaves carelessly.
Also we use (don’t- with plural) and ( doesn’t with singular).
Example:
Engineers prospect for oil Engineers don’t prospect for
oil.
A scientist makes experiments A scientist doesn’t make
experiments .
6. Interrogative
We use (do – with plural) and (does – with singular).
Example:
They live in Cairo Do they live in Cairo?
He works as a professor Does he work as
a professor?
